About

 

I’m an Emmy, Peabody, and duPont Columbia award-winning documentary filmmaker, primarily focused on environmental conflict and migration. I run a production company called Documist with my best friends.

Most recently I produced Nuisance Bear (A24 / Sundance 2026 US Documentary Grand Jury Prize winner), which was expanded from our Oscar-shortlisted short film. I also produced The Territory (National Geographic / Sundance 2022), which won two Sundance awards, a Primetime Emmy for ‘Exceptional Merit in Documentary Filmmaking’, and a Peabody Award. It was also nominated for 7x Cinema Eye Awards, 3x Critics Choice Awards, a Gotham Award, and was Oscar-shortlisted. I’ve also produced and edited numerous short films, including Unsafe Passage (Guardian Documentaries / Emmy winner, NPPA Documentary of the Year); Squid Fleet (The New Yorker / Camerimage Golden Frog nominee); and Filmed in Gaza (NBC Digital Docs / 3x Emmy nominee, Peabody finalist, Webby nominee).

Before that, I worked primarily on short films and digital features for outlets including National Geographic, the Economist, The New York Times, The Guardian, The New Yorker, NBC, and BBC. I have also worked extensively for commercial and non-profit clients around the world.

One thing I truly enjoy is teaching and sharing the craft of documentary. I have given dozens of workshops and worked on a range of participatory multimedia projects in the US, Canada, Kenya, Haiti, the Philippines, and Brazil; from art projects for kids, to evidentiary techniques for human rights defenders, to masterclasses for aspiring cinematographers.

I’ve worked in over 30 countries and speak English and Spanish fluently, as well as Portuguese and French conversationally.
